声波波束形成库
项目描述
阿科拉尔
Acoular 是一个用于声学波束成形的 Python 模块,在新的 BSD 许可下分发。
它的目标是在声学测试中的应用。可以对麦克风阵列记录的多通道数据进行处理和分析,以生成声源分布的映射。然后可以使用地图(声学照片)来定位感兴趣的源并使用它们的光谱来表征它们。
特征
涵盖了几种波束形成算法
不同的高级反卷积算法
包括时域和频域操作
可进行 3D 映射
用于固定目标和移动目标
支持脚本和图形用户界面
高效:智能缓存、使用 Numba 进行并行计算
易于扩展且有据可查
依赖项
Acoular 在 Linux、Windows 和 MacOS 下运行,需要安装 Python 3.9、3.8、3.7 或 3.6 以及可用的 Numpy、Scipy、Traits、scikit-learn、pytables、numba 包。推荐使用 Matplotlib,但不是必需的。
项目详情
下载文件
下载适用于您平台的文件。如果您不确定要选择哪个,请了解有关安装包的更多信息。
源分布
acoular-22.3.tar.gz
(129.8 kB
查看哈希)
内置分布
acoular-22.3-py3-none-any.whl
(148.7 kB
查看哈希)